Born in 1983, played ice hockey at the professional level in the NHL. Played as a forward and contributed to team efforts at various stages of his career. Most notable achievement includes winning the Stanley Cup in 2007 with the Anaheim Ducks. Also played for teams including the Minnesota Wild and the New Jersey Devils during his career, participating in numerous playoff games and showcasing skills that supported team success during those times.

Ascended the throne in 1905 after Norway's independence from Sweden. Led Norway as a constitutional monarch during World War II, providing a symbol of resistance against Nazi occupation. Worked to maintain Norway's sovereignty and unity, often collaborating with exiled government officials. After the war, played a role in the restoration of the monarchy's reputation and helped Norway's integration into post-war Europe.
